All sections of the club are now open in one way or another but it is important to note that the clubhouse is not open and no-one should attempt to enter the clubhouse.

Members who wish to use the grounds for Running & Training are now able to do so.  This does not cover the astro-turf pitches for which separate guidelines will be provided.   It is essential that any members wishing to run/train must follow the same guidelines as other Sports when using the grounds, namely:

  • Running/Training on the grounds at BRSC is for Members only
  • When using the car park park a safe distance from other cars
  • The Clubhouse will not be open, so there will be NO toilet facilities available
  • Small groups not larger than 6 people
  • Social distancing should be observed at all times
  • Please bring your own drink/food and take them away with you, including any rubbish!
